As our beloved feline companions age, they require special attention and care to ensure their health, comfort, and quality of life. Senior Scottish Fold cats, known for their distinctive folded ears and affectionate nature, may experience age-related changes in their physical condition, behavior, and overall well-being. To support your aging Scottish Fold cat in their golden years, it is essential to provide them with tailored care, regular veterinary check-ups, and a supportive environment that addresses their specific needs as senior pets. In this comprehensive guide, we will explore essential health and wellness tips to help you care for your senior Scottish Fold cat and ensure they enjoy a happy and comfortable life as they age gracefully.

1. Regular Veterinary Check-Ups

Scheduled veterinary visits are crucial for monitoring the health of your senior Scottish Fold cat. Routine check-ups allow your veterinarian to assess your cat's overall condition, detect any potential health issues early, and provide appropriate medical care or interventions as needed.

2. Nutritious Diet

Senior cats have unique dietary requirements that cater to their changing nutritional needs. Consider transitioning your aging Scottish Fold to a specially formulated senior cat food that supports joint health, digestive function, and weight management. Ensure that their diet is rich in high-quality protein, essential vitamins, and minerals to promote optimal well-being.

3. Weight Management

Maintaining a healthy weight is vital for the well-being of senior cats, including Scottish Folds. Monitor your cat's weight regularly and adjust their diet as necessary to prevent obesity or excessive weight loss, both of which can impact their mobility, energy levels, and overall health.

4. Dental Care

Dental health plays a significant role in the overall wellness of senior cats. Dental problems, such as periodontal disease or tooth decay, can lead to discomfort, difficulty eating, and systemic health issues. Practice good dental hygiene by brushing your cat's teeth regularly and providing dental treats or toys to support oral health.

5. Comfortable Environment

Create a cozy and comfortable environment for your senior Scottish Fold cat by offering soft bedding, warm resting spots, and easy access to food, water, and litter boxes. Consider providing ramps or steps to help them navigate elevated areas, especially if mobility issues arise with age.

6. Exercise and Mental Stimulation

Encourage gentle exercise and mental stimulation to keep your senior Scottish Fold active and engaged. Interactive play sessions, puzzle feeders, and low-impact activities can help maintain muscle tone, cognitive function, and emotional well-being in aging felines.

7. Joint Health Support

Senior cats, including Scottish Folds, may experience arthritis or joint stiffness as they age. Consider incorporating supplements or diets rich in Omega-3 fatty acids and glucosamine to support joint health, reduce inflammation, and alleviate discomfort associated with mobility issues.

8. Hydration and Water Accessibility

Ensure that your senior Scottish Fold has access to fresh water at all times to prevent dehydration and support kidney function. Consider providing multiple water sources throughout your home and using shallow, easily accessible bowls to encourage adequate hydration.

9. Stress Reduction

Minimize stressors in your senior Scottish Fold's environment to promote emotional well-being and reduce anxiety. Create quiet spaces, offer familiar comforts, and maintain a consistent routine to provide a sense of security and stability for your aging cat.

10. Quality Time and Affection

Spend quality time with your senior Scottish Fold cat, offering gentle grooming, cuddles, and reassurance. The bond you share with your cat plays a significant role in their emotional health and provides comfort and companionship as they navigate the challenges of aging.
